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Sign of Mold: If you notice persistent musty odors in your building, it may be a sign of m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Sign of Leaks: If you notice water stains on ceilings or walls, it may show a hidden leak that needs to be addressed before it causes further damage.

Flooded Areas or Standing Water

Sign of Emergency: If you face standing water or flooded areas,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Sign of Water Damage: If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it may be a sign of underlying water damage that needs to be addressed.

Discoloration or Warping of Walls

Sign of Hidden Leaks: If you notice discoloration or warping of walls, it may show a hidden leak that needs to be addressed before it causes further damage.

Unusual Odors or Foul Smells

Sign of Mold or Bacteria: If you notice unusual odors or foul smells in your building, it may be a sign of mold or bacterial growth that needs to be addressed.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small Water Spill Yes No DIY is usually fine for small spills, but be sure to clean and dry the area quickly to prevent damage.
Major Flood Damage No Yes Major flood dam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ough restoration.
Hidden Leaks No Yes Hidden leaks can cause significant damage if not addressed quickly, making it essential to call a professional.
Water Damage in Sensitive Areas No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as, such as electrical systems or HVAC units, needs specialized care and expertise to prevent further damage.
Certified Water Damage No Yes Certified water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ure a thorough and efficient restoration process.
Insurance Claim No Yes Insurance claims for water damage can be complex, making it essential to call a professional to ensure a smooth and successful claims process.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in St. Peter, MN

Estimating the cost of commercial water damage restoration can be challenging, as it dep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in St. Peter, MN. But, our team can provide a personalized est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ized restoration plan.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, duration of drying process
Disinfecting and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Type of materials affected, extent of cleaning needed
Reconstruction and Repair $1,500 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, type of materials needed
